About iShares S&P 500 BuyWrite ETF
The iShares S&P 500 BuyWrite ETF (IVVW) is an exchange-traded fund that mostly invests in large cap equity. The fund is passively managed, aiming to participate in the price movement of US large-cap stocks, up to a certain cap, while also providing enhanced monthly income through a covered call option writing strategy. The fund-of-fund holds shares of the iShares Core S&P 500 ETF (IVV) while simultaneously writing one-month call options. IVVW was launched on Mar 14, 2024 and is issued by BlackRock.
